Man's Dress Shirt to Adorable Top

I found this  Michael Kors man's dress shirt, a gem, at a neighborhood wide garage sale for $2.  Needless to say, I was in heaven.  I loved the print, but it was a bit baggy for me.


I had a vision for this shirt right from the beginning.  My plan was to turn it around backwards.

Terrible photo, but it's backwards.
 I then cut the top of, right below the back panel.  


There was just enough room left in the sleeve area to make new sleeves.  So I sewed up the top, right sides together, and put it on Dotty to fashion a new collar line and size it up.



Next, I tacked the pleats down, folded the collar line over and stitched it up.  The back had a small slit at the top, so I added a snap to keep it shut.  I stitched around the sleeve holes, and presto!  New adorable top!
